Comparative virulence properties of epizootic strains of <i>Escherichia coli</i> bacteria

Abstract

The results of the study to determine the virulence of production strains and epizootic isolates of Escherichia coli isolated in the Moscow and Tula regions in livestock farms and in the private sector from 2016 to 2022 are presented. In the experiment, the virulence of Escherichia coli was studied by determining the LD50 of Escherichia coli isolates for biological test systems. The most virulent strain from the museum collection was E. coli No. TP-85; the most avirulent were E. coli No. 727 and E. coli No. D616. The isolates selected by us showed the following results: the most virulent were E. coli 22/20, E. coli 3/16, E. сoli 20/20, E. coli 24/21 – E. coli 7/16, E. coli 19/2, E. coli 18/20, E. coli 9/17, E. coli 5/16, E. coli 28/21, E. coli 29/21. Avirulent were the isolates E. coli 25/21 and E. coli 17/20. LD50 for them was 22,36 × 108. The study of museum strains of E. coli isolates compared with the isolates obtained in the Moscow and Tula regions led to the conclusion that during long-term storage of collection strains, their virulence decreases. The tendency of strains to lose their physicochemical properties (stability) during lyophilization has also been noted. There could be several reasons for this: imperfect control and storage at different stages of the culture life cycle; improper lyophilization drying when strains were not deep-frozen; and failure to follow drying steps, which over time led to a change in the genetic structure of the strain.
